الگوریتم رمزنگاری Rivest-Shamir-Adleman) RSA) : تاریخچه و پیاده سازی
سال انتشار: 1403
نوع سند: مقاله کنفرانسی
زبان: فارسی
مشاهده: 127
فایل این مقاله در 6 صفحه با فرمت PDF قابل دریافت می باشد
- صدور گواهی نمایه سازی
- من نویسنده این مقاله هستم
استخراج به نرم افزارهای پژوهشی:
شناسه ملی سند علمی:
BECE02_045
تاریخ نمایه سازی: 2 مرداد 1403
چکیده مقاله:
در عصر دیجیتال، اطلاعات به یکی از باارزشترین دارایی ها برای افراد، سازمان ها و دولت ها تبدیل شده است. به همین دلیل، بحث امنیتاطلاعات از هر زمان دیگری داغتر و حساس تر شده است. رمزنگاری به عنوان یکی از امنترین و کارآمدترین روشها برای تضمین امنیتاطلاعات، نقشی حیاتی ایفا می کند. علاوه بر محرمانه نگه داشتن اطلاعات، رمزنگاری به همراه امضای دیجیتال، اصالت و عدم انکار اطلاعاترا نیز تضمین میکند. به طور خلاصه، هدف نهایی تکنیک های رمزنگاری، حفظ سه اصل محرمانگی، یکپارچگی و عدم انکار اطلاعات است .الگوریتم های رمزنگاری به دو دسته کلی متقارن و نامتقارن تقسیم می شوند. در حال حاضر، الگوریتم های نامتقارن به دلیل استفاده از دوکلید مجزا برای رمزگذاری (کلید عمومی) و رمزگشایی (کلید خصوصی)، کاربرد گسترده تری نسبت به نوع متقارن دارند . در میانالگوریتم های نامتقارن، RSA به عنوان یکی از قدرتمندترین و شناخته شده ترین روش ها، جایگاه ویژهای دارد. این الگوریتم که برای اولینبار در سال ۱۷۹۱ توسط Rivest ، Shamir و Adleman معرفی شد، در مقاله ای با عنوان "یک روش برای به دست آوردن امضایدیجیتال و سیستم های رمزنگاری کلید عمومی" به تفصیل شرح داده شده است . در این مقاله، به بررسی پیشینه و نحوه عملکرد الگوریتمRSA و نحوه پیاده سازی با زبان برنامه نویسی پایتون به طور کامل پرداخته می شود.
کلیدواژه ها:
نویسندگان
بهنام قهرمان خانی
گروه کامپیوتر، دانشکده فنی واحد لاهیجان، دانشگاه آزاد اسلامی، لاهیجان،ایران
سودابه پورذاکرعربانی
کامپیوتر، دانشکده فنی واحد لاهیجان، دانشگاه آزاد اسلامی، لاهیجان،ایران